vscode无法解析变量怎么解决

fiy 其他 408

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    解决VS Code无法解析变量的方法有以下几种:

    1. 检查配置:首先要确保你在VS Code中正确配置了项目的路径和文件。在VS Code的设置中,找到“文件关联”或“语言配置”选项,并确保正确地关联了你正在使用的编程语言。

    2. 安装插件:VS Code有许多插件可扩展其功能。通过安装适合你使用的编程语言的插件,可以提供更好的语法高亮、自动补全等功能,从而帮助VS Code更好地解析变量。

    3. 更新相关依赖库:如果你的项目使用了一些外部的依赖库或扩展,可能是因为版本不兼容或缺少更新而导致VS Code无法正确解析变量。请确保你的依赖库和扩展都是最新的版本,并按照它们的文档进行正确配置。

    4. 检查代码语法错误:如果你的代码存在语法错误,VS Code可能无法正确解析变量。仔细检查代码中的语法错误,并修复它们。在VS Code中使用内置的语法检查工具(如ESLint、RuboCop等)也可以帮助你发现和修复这些错误。

    5. 清除缓存:有时候,VS Code可能出现缓存问题,导致无法正确解析变量。尝试清除VS Code的缓存并重新启动。在 VS Code 的设置中,找到“高级”选项,并选择“重置所有设置到默认值”,然后重新启动 VS Code。

    6. 重新安装VS Code:如果以上方法都没有解决问题,那么尝试重新安装VS Code可能是最后的选择。卸载VS Code并重新下载安装最新版本的VS Code,并按照上述步骤重新配置和调整插件,可能能解决无法解析变量的问题。

    希望以上方法能帮助你解决VS Code无法解析变量的问题。如果问题仍然存在,请参考VS Code官方文档或向相关社区求助,以寻求更专业的帮助。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    解决VSCode无法解析变量的问题可以尝试以下几种方法:

    1. 检查语言模式:确保你正在使用正确的语言模式。VSCode根据文件的扩展名自动选择语言模式,有时会选择错误的语言模式导致无法解析变量。你可以手动更改语言模式,右下角可以看到当前的语言模式,点击可以切换到正确的语言模式。

    2. 安装相应的插件:某些语言的变量解析可能需要特定的插件来支持。在VSCode的扩展市场中搜索并安装相关的插件,例如C++插件、Python插件等,以获得更好的变量解析功能。

    3. 配置include路径:对于某些语言,如果你的项目使用了自定义的include路径,VSCode可能无法正确解析变量。在VSCode的设置中,搜索”includePath”或者”IntelliSense include path”等相关设置,将你的项目的include路径添加到这个设置中,这样VSCode就可以正确地解析变量了。

    4. 更新相关工具链:如果你使用的是某个特定语言的工具链,例如GCC、Clang等,尝试更新这些工具链到最新版本。有时,旧版本的工具链可能无法正确解析变量,更新工具链可以修复这个问题。

    5. 检查代码错误:有时无法解析变量是因为代码本身存在错误,例如语法错误、未定义的变量等。仔细检查代码,修复其中的错误可以使得VSCode能够正确解析变量。

    最后,如果以上方法仍然无法解决问题,你可以尝试重启VSCode或重新安装VSCode,有时这些简单的操作可以修复一些奇怪的问题。另外,如果你在使用VSCode的过程中遇到其他问题,可以参考VSCode的官方文档或使用者社区,寻找相关的解决方案。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    问题描述

    在使用 Visual Studio Code(以下简称 VSCode)进行编码时,出现了无法解析变量的问题。即在代码中定义的变量无法被 VSCode 正确识别、提示和补全。

    解决方法

    要解决这个问题,可以尝试以下几种方法:

    1. 安装适当的插件

    在 VSCode 中,我们可以通过安装适合的插件来增强其功能。在解决无法解析变量的问题上,可以尝试安装一些与代码补全、代码提示相关的插件。

    常用的插件有:

    – IntelliSense for CSS class names in HTML
    – ESLint
    – React Native Tools(仅适用于开发 React Native 项目)

    安装这些插件后,重启 VSCode 并打开相应的代码文件,看看是否解决了无法解析变量的问题。

    2. 配置相应的配置文件

    VSCode 支持对各种类型的文件进行不同的配置。有时,我们需要手动配置一些文件以启用变量解析。

    例如,对于 TypeScript 文件,我们可以在项目根目录下创建一个 `tsconfig.json` 文件,并添加一些配置以启用变量解析。具体配置可以参考 TypeScript 官方文档。

    对于其他类型的文件,可以根据文件类型进行相应的配置。例如,对于 JavaScript 文件,可以创建一个 `.jsconfig.json` 文件,并添加一些配置。

    3. 检查项目文件结构

    有时,无法解析变量是由于项目文件结构不正确导致的。在使用 VSCode 开发项目时,需要将项目文件放置在正确的位置,并保持正确的文件结构。

    可以检查一下项目的文件结构是否正确,包括文件是否放置在正确的位置、文件夹是否正确命名等。如果发现错误,可以尝试进行调整并重启 VSCode。

    4. 更新 VSCode 版本和插件

    VSCode 和插件的更新版本通常会修复一些已知问题。如果你使用的是较旧的版本,可以尝试更新 VSCode 到最新版本,并更新已安装的插件。

    进入 VSCode 的扩展视图,找到已安装插件并检查是否有更新可用。如果有更新,可以点击“更新”按钮来更新插件。

    总结

    无法解析变量的问题可能是由于未安装适当的插件、配置文件错误、项目文件结构不正确或者版本过旧等原因导致的。通过安装适当的插件、正确配置相关的配置文件、检查项目文件结构并更新 VSCode 和插件,可以解决无法解析变量的问题。希望以上方法对你有所帮助。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部